WuXi PharmaTech's toxicology facility is located in Suzhou

Singapore: Pharmaceutical, biotechnology and medical device research and development outsourcing company WuXi PharmaTech's Suzhou toxicology facility, with operations in China and the US, has received accreditation from  Association for the Assessment and Accreditation of Laboratory Animal Care International (AAALAC) after an extensive on-site evaluation.

The AAALAC Committee on Accreditation commended the facility for "providing and maintaining an exemplary program of animal care". 

AAALAC is a private, nonprofit organization that promotes the humane treatment of animals in science through voluntary accreditation and assessment programs. It evaluates all aspects of an animal care and use program, including institutional policies, animal husbandry, veterinary care and the physical plant.

In its evaluations, it relies on widely accepted guidelines, such as the Guide for the Care and Use of Laboratory Animals and other reference resources, as well as its own position statements and Rules of Accreditation.
